How to Fill Out Procedures and Guidelines:

01
Start by familiarizing yourself with the purpose and scope of the procedures and guidelines. Understand why they are necessary and what they aim to accomplish.
02
Read through the existing procedures and guidelines, if any, to gain insight into the organization's expectations. Make note of any updates or revisions that may be required.
03
Identify the key stakeholders and subject matter experts who should be involved in the process. These individuals can provide valuable input and ensure that the procedures and guidelines align with best practices in the relevant field.
04
Conduct thorough research to gather relevant information and gather insights from industry standards and regulations. This will help you ensure that the procedures and guidelines are up-to-date and in compliance with applicable laws or guidelines.
05
Begin creating a draft of the procedures and guidelines. Structure them in a logical and easy-to-follow manner, with clear instructions and explanations. Break down complex processes into smaller, manageable steps.
06
Make sure to include any necessary templates, forms, or checklists that may be required to facilitate the implementation of these procedures and guidelines.
07
Review the draft with the identified stakeholders and subject matter experts. Seek their feedback and input to ensure that all perspectives are considered and incorporated.
08
Make necessary revisions based on the feedback received. Aim for clarity, simplicity, and user-friendliness in the final document.
09
Once the procedures and guidelines have been finalized, share them with the relevant individuals or teams in the organization. Conduct training sessions, if necessary, to ensure that everyone understands and can follow the established procedures.
10
Regularly review and update the procedures and guidelines to accommodate any changes in the organization's processes, applicable laws, or industry standards. Encourage feedback from users to continuously improve and refine these documents.

Who Needs Procedures and Guidelines:

01
Organizations: Procedures and guidelines are essential for organizations of all sizes and types. They establish a framework for consistent and efficient operations, ensuring that everyone is aware of the expected processes and standards.
02
Employees: Procedures and guidelines provide employees with clear instructions and guidance on how to perform their roles effectively. They help maintain consistency and reduce errors or misunderstandings.
03
Customers or Clients: Procedures and guidelines can also benefit customers or clients by ensuring a consistent and reliable experience when interacting with the organization. They establish expectations and provide transparency in processes.
04
Regulatory Bodies: In certain industries, regulatory bodies require organizations to have specific procedures and guidelines in place to ensure compliance with laws and regulations. Failure to adhere to these guidelines can result in penalties or legal consequences.
05
Quality Assurance and Auditors: Procedures and guidelines are crucial for quality assurance and auditing purposes. They provide a reference point to assess the effectiveness and efficiency of an organization's operations.
In conclusion, filling out procedures and guidelines requires a systematic approach, involving research, collaboration, and continuous improvement. They are essential for organizations and individuals to ensure consistency, efficiency, and compliance in their operations.
